Transaction 323073ef18971753dd5a3034639a05db94e24e23b4c8c024060516d859f243b1
1 Input
1 Output
-
323073ef18971753dd5a3034639a05db94e24e23b4c8c024060516d859f243b1:0
- value
- 562450
- script pubkey
- OP_0 OP_PUSHBYTES_20 992185f57aa403b6df30eda45d09a242ec23b360
- address
- bc1qnysctat65spmdhesakj96zdzgtkz8vmq4ganh9